[SET]
(HP, Def) Zapdos @ Heavy-Duty Boots
Ability: Static
EVs: 252 HP / 252 Def / 4 SpD
Tera Type: Steel
Bold Nature
- Hurricane
- Roost
- Discharge / Thunder Wave
- U-turn / Volt Switch
[SET COMMENTS]
Zapdos is a reliable physically defensive pivot in Godly Gift, taking advantage of an HP or Defense donation alongside its typing to check physical attackers like Zacian-C and Ogerpon. Heavy-Duty Boots allows it to ignore entry hazards, letting it repeatedly switch in throughout the game to check threats and generate momentum. Hurricane prevents Zapdos from being overly passive. Discharge can be used alongside U-turn to enable pivoting on Ground-types, while Thunder Wave can be used with Volt Switch to more consistently paralyze foes. Static further punishes contact moves, potentially crippling physical attackers like Zamazenta and Roaring Moon. Tera Steel improves Zapdos’s defensive profile significantly, granting key resistances to Rock- and Ice-type moves and allowing it to better handle threats such as Weavile and Calyrex-Ice, while Tera Grass mainly functions to check Ogerpon-W, although it also helps against foes like Zekrom.
Zapdos fits best on balance and bulky offense teams that value a durable pivot and physical blanket check. It usually pairs well with higher HP or Defense donations such as Lunala or Kyurem-W's HP or Calyrex-Ice's Defense. Zapdos naturally forms strong cores with bulky teammates such as Galarian Slowking, Ting-Lu, and Great Tusk, which can handle special attackers that Zapdos struggles with. In return, Zapdos can switch into Ground-type moves aimed at them and bring them in safely with its pivoting moves. Frailer wallbreakers like Weavile and Ogerpon greatly appreciate Zapdos’s ability to bring them in safely, allowing them more opportunities to break through opposing teams. Zapdos's ability to consistently spread paralysis is also appreciated by slower teammates, such as Calm Mind Lunala and Swords Dance Excadrill. Also, as Zapdos is vulnerable to hazards without Heavy-Duty Boots, it appreciates having either teammates that can absorb Knock Off like Clefable and Landorus-T, or hazard removal such as the aforementioned Great Tusk.
